The BMW 3er, specifically the 2.3 AT (139 hp) model, is a quintessential representation of German automotive excellence. Produced between 1983 and 1991, this sedan has stood the test of time, offering a blend of performance, comfort, and reliability. As a member of the D-class, it caters to those who appreciate a balance between luxury and practicality. With its four-door design, the BMW 3er is perfect for families or individuals seeking a stylish yet functional vehicle.
Under the hood, the BMW 3er boasts a 2.3-liter inline-6 petrol engine, delivering 139 horsepower at 6000 rpm and 205 Nm of torque at 4000 rpm. The engine features a distributed injection system, ensuring efficient fuel delivery and smooth performance. Paired with a 4-speed automatic transmission and rear-wheel drive, this car offers a dynamic driving experience. Its acceleration and handling are well-suited for both city driving and long-distance journeys, making it a versatile choice for various driving conditions.
The BMW 3er's design is a testament to timeless elegance. Measuring 4321 mm in length, 1641 mm in width, and 1379 mm in height, it strikes a perfect balance between compactness and spaciousness. The wheelbase of 2570 mm ensures stability, while the ground clearance of 140 mm allows for confident navigation on uneven roads. The car's 195/65/R14 wheels provide excellent grip and contribute to its overall stability and comfort.
Inside, the BMW 3er offers a comfortable and well-appointed cabin. The trunk provides a minimum volume of 425 liters, making it practical for everyday use and longer trips. The fuel tank capacity of 55 liters ensures fewer stops at the pump, enhancing the car's convenience for long drives. The independent spring suspension on both the front and rear ensures a smooth ride, absorbing road imperfections with ease.
Safety is a priority in the BMW 3er, with front disc brakes and rear drum brakes providing reliable stopping power. The car's suspension system, combined with its braking capabilities, ensures a secure and controlled driving experience. While it may lack some modern safety features, its robust build and engineering make it a dependable choice for those who value safety and performance.
